English meaning
- agitation noun A state of anxiety, restlessness, or emotional disturbance.
- excitation noun The act of exciting or putting in motion; the act of rousing up or awakening.
- excitement noun A strong feeling of eagerness, thrill, or enthusiasm.
- flutter verb To flap or move quickly and irregularly.
- fume noun A strong-smelling or harmful gas or vapor.
Senses
възбуда is used for these senses in English:
- agitation The act of agitating, or the state of being agitated; the state of being disrupted with violence, or with irregular action; commotion.
- excitation (physiology) The activity produced in an organ, tissue, or part, such as a nerve cell, as a result of stimulation.
- excitement (uncountable) The state of being excited (emotionally aroused).
- flutter A state of agitation.
- fume Rage or excitement which deprives the mind of self-control.
agitation — full definition
- noun A state of anxiety, restlessness, or emotional disturbance.
- noun Organized, public effort to push for political or social change.
- noun The act of stirring or shaking something, especially to mix it.
excitation — full definition
- noun The act of exciting or putting in motion; the act of rousing up or awakening.
- noun The act of producing excitement (stimulation); also, the excitement produced.
- noun The activity produced in an organ, tissue, or part, such as a nerve cell, as a result of stimulation.
- noun A transition of a nucleus, atom or molecule to an excited state by the absorption of a quantum of energy; the opposite of relaxation.
